Where We are Now
Brownfield Grants Received by Energize-ECI Regional Planning District
-
| Indiana Brownfield Grant |
$58,198 |
Muncie Paper Processing Site - Muncie
Phase I and Phase II Assessments |
Delaware County |
-
| Indiana Brownfield Grant |
$38,627 |
Sodder Lumber Yard Site – Hartford City
Phase I and Phase II Assessments |
Blackford County |
-
| Brownfield Trails & Parks Grant |
$22,481 |
1605 E. Main St. Site – Muncie
Phase II Assessments |
Delaware County |
-
| U.S. EPA Brownfield Assessment Grant |
$609,000 |
ECI Brownfields Coalition
Blackford, Delaware, Grant & Jay Counties
Brownfield Inventory and Assessment – Priority Sites

Progress Summary / Project Updates
-
| Muncie Paper Processing Site – Muncie |
Delaware County |
Completed Phase I and Phase II Assessments
Clean-Up Phase is being planned, with ideas for redevelopment
Delaware County Redevelopment Commission is coordinating these steps
|
-
| Former Sodders Lumber Yard Site – Hartford City |
Blackford County |
Completed Phase I Assessment
Hartford City Mayor researching next steps to take on project
|
-
| 1605 E. Main Street Site – Muncie |
Delaware County |
Completed Phase I and Phase II Assessments
Clean-Up Phase in being planned, with ideas for redeveloping this former service station property
Delaware County Redevelopment Commission is coordinating the next steps
